Intro
As a house owner, acknowledging indicators that show your home demands prompt plumbing attention is important for protecting against expensive damage and aggravation. Allow's explore a few of the top indicators you should never overlook.
Lowered Water Pressure
One of the most common indicators of plumbing problems is reduced water pressure. If you discover a considerable decrease in water pressure in your faucets or showerheads, it could signal underlying troubles such as pipeline leakages, mineral build-up, or issues with the water system line.

Parasite Infestations
Bugs such as roaches, rodents, and bugs are brought in to moisture and water sources, making water leakages and broken pipelines perfect breeding premises. If you see a rise in insect activity, it could be an indicator of plumbing problems that require to be dealt with.
Unpleasant Smells
Foul odors originating from drains or sewage system lines are not just unpleasant yet additionally a sign of plumbing issues. Drain odors might suggest a damaged sewage system line or a dried-out P-trap, while moldy smells could signal mold development from water leakages.
Visible Water Damages
Water stains on wall surfaces or ceilings, along with mold and mildew or mildew growth, are clear signs of water leakages that need immediate focus. Overlooking these indications can bring about architectural damage, endangered interior air high quality, and costly repair work.
Odd Noises
Gurgling, knocking, or whistling sounds coming from your plumbing system are not typical and should be explored immediately. These noises could be brought on by problems such as air in the pipelines, loose installations, or water hammer-- a sensation where water flow is suddenly quit.
Foundation Cracks
Fractures in your house's structure might suggest underlying plumbing problems, specifically if they coincide with water-related issues inside. Water leakages from pipes or drain lines can create dirt disintegration, bring about foundation negotiation and fractures.
Mold and mildew Development
The presence of mold or mold in your home, particularly in wet or inadequately ventilated locations, shows excess dampness-- a typical consequence of water leaks. Mold and mildew not just harms surface areas yet also poses wellness dangers to residents, making punctual plumbing fixings necessary.
Slow Drainage
Sluggish drainage is one more red flag that shouldn't be overlooked. If water takes longer than typical to drain pipes from sinks, showers, or tubs, it can indicate an obstruction in the pipes. Overlooking this issue can cause complete blockages and prospective water damages.
Abrupt Rise in Water Costs
If you observe an unexpected spike in your water costs without a corresponding boost in usage, it's a strong indicator of covert leakages. Even small leakages can lose significant amounts of water gradually, leading to filled with air water expenses.
Final thought
Recognizing the signs that your home demands instant plumbing focus is essential for stopping substantial damage and costly repairs. By remaining alert and addressing plumbing concerns immediately, you can maintain a risk-free, practical, and comfy living setting for you and your household.
HOW TO KNOW IF YOUR HOUSE NEEDS PLUMBING MAINTENANCE?
Your home’s plumbing system plays a vital role in ensuring the smooth flow of water and maintaining a comfortable living environment. However, over time, wear and tear can occur, leading to plumbing issues that can disrupt your daily routine. To avoid costly repairs and unexpected emergencies, regular plumbing maintenance is essential. If you are asking how to know if your house needs a plumbing maintenance, here are some key signs to watch for and maintenance tips to keep your home’s water systems in excellent condition.
Watch for Warning Signs.
Several indicators can suggest that your home needs plumbing maintenance. These signs include slow drainage, low water pressure, recurring leaks, foul odors, and unusual sounds coming from the pipes. Pay attention to these warnings as they can indicate underlying issues that require immediate attention.
Schedule Regular Inspections.
Preventive maintenance is crucial to catch plumbing problems before they escalate. Consider scheduling regular inspections with a professional plumber who can assess your plumbing system for any hidden leaks, corrosion, or potential issues. Regular inspections can help you identify problems early on, saving you from costly repairs and water damage.
Maintain Drainage Systems.
Clogged drains are a common plumbing issue that can lead to water backups and other complications. Avoid pouring grease, coffee grounds, or other debris down the drain, and use drain covers to prevent hair and debris from entering the pipes. Regularly clean your drains using natural remedies or approved drain cleaners to keep them clear. Winterize Your Plumbing.
In colder climates, freezing temperatures can cause pipes to burst, leading to significant water damage. Before the winter season arrives, insulate exposed pipes, disconnect outdoor hoses, and consider installing pipe insulation sleeves. Taking these preventive measures can protect your plumbing system during freezing weather.
Regular plumbing maintenance is essential for a well-functioning home. By paying attention to warning signs, scheduling inspections, maintaining drainage systems, and winterizing your plumbing, you can prevent costly repairs and ensure a smoothly running water system. Remember, proactive maintenance is the key to a hassle-free and functional home.
